The 2019 Jeep Cherokee includes a start-stop system as a standard feature. This feature is designed to improve fuel efficiency in your SUV. When your vehicle comes to a complete stop with this feature activated, the engine will shut off. Once you release the brake and press the accelerator, the engine will automatically restart. This system helps decrease fuel consumption while the vehicle is stopped and idling, potentially saving you money in the long term. Many vehicles now come equipped with this feature to help lower carbon emissions.
Stop/start technology is a feature found in modern vehicles that automatically turns off the engine when the vehicle is stationary to save fuel. To activate stop/start, the brake pedal needs to be fully pressed, the car must be in a forward gear, and the vehicle must be completely stopped. In a Jeep Cherokee, this function is called "Stop and Go" and is available on all trim levels of the 2018 model. When activated, a green light on the dashboard will indicate that the vehicle is in stop/start mode.
